Having lived in Wyoming, I'm biased to say that they're the best. Absolutely gorgeous if you head out west. Summers are mild, but winters are pretty brutal. I hope you like snow and wind. Other than that, friendly people, decent taxes other than property taxes, lots of BLM land to have fun on, and the most pro gun state in the Union
